How A Frozen Bank Account Inspired Bitcoin Advocates To Try Life By Bitcoin Standards.
As Bitcoin BTC ($16,833), acceptance of continues to sow seeds around the world, with more and more people choosing to accept the original cryptocurrency as payment for goods and services. For individuals, this means accepting her BTC as salary.
A Florida-based bitcoin advocate named SVN (not his real name) had received all of his salaries in BTC for the past year. Cointelegraph reached out to SVN, who works in the animation industry, to understand why he did so and whether there are tangible benefits to acquiring the world’s most popular cryptocurrency.
SVN explained that when the bank froze one of his accounts, he “turned to Bitcoin as a solution to sustaining my livelihood while the issue was resolved.” did.
